Simultaneously fascinating and terrifying
Reviewed: 03-20-18
Any additional comments?
Even though I knew keeping information private online wasn't easy...little did I know the myriad of ways that we compromise our privacy - often unwittingly - to corporations and hackers alike. The book is at once fascinating and terrifying ... and the narration is perfect for the material.
What's good is that once you're told how about how you could be giving away your privacy or being hacked, the author presents concrete tools and tips for mitigating the risks - from small everyday things to "Snowden-level" tactics.
Only thing is ... there are so many references to tools, websites, software etc., that a resource PDF would have made a great addition.
